Hey future maintainers,

We ran the quarterly disaster-recovery drill on Flagpole (our feature-flag rollout framework) last Thursday. Short version: failover to the Brindlewood replica worked, but restoring the flag-state snapshot took 40 minutes because nobody remembered where the sealed recovery credentials lived. Fixing that now. Tansy updated the runbook, and the drill doc lives in the Flagpole wiki under "DR 2024-Q3." If you ever need to unseal the snapshot store, use the passphrase below.

unlock words, hahip-baduf: holwyn-istath-julvan

Meeting notes — Penmill render pipeline (excerpt)

For the new contractor: the Penmill pipeline converts markdown through three stages — sanitize, transform, cache. Do not bypass the sanitize stage, even for trusted input; this caused the Harrowgate incident last quarter. Custom extensions go through the transform registry only. All pipeline changes, however small, require review by the owner named below.

account owner for kafop-haweg: Pelax Gilael Istir

Subject: Key rotation — Sproutly Watering Scheduler

Team, ahead of Thursday's sync: the Sproutly scheduler's credential for the RainRoute irrigation API rotates tonight at 22:00. The old key stops working immediately after cutover, so please update any local test configs before then. Staging has already been migrated and verified. For your convenience, the new key for the scheduler service is included below.

gateway credential: qvz15-KH6w5OvQFD1Z8FT

Ticket: Pick-list optimizer sign-off needed. The Cartographer optimizer for the Dunmere warehouse now batches picks by aisle zone instead of order age. Simulation shows 12% shorter walk paths but occasional SLA risk on rush orders. Change is staged, feature-flagged, and reversible within one deploy. On-call: do not enable the flag manually; rollout is scheduled pending sign-off. If rush-order SLA alerts fire post-rollout, disable the flag and page the owner. Sign-off is required from the person named below.

named custodian: Brivan Eliath Quenox Frador